Coca-Cola Amphitheater set to open with star-packed 2025 lineup

After years of planning and construction, the long-awaited Coca-Cola Amphitheater in Birmingham’s Druid Hills neighborhood is set to open its gates Sunday, with a full slate of concerts, comedy shows, and cultural events on deck. The $46 million venue, built on the former Carraway Hospital site as part of the Star Uptown redevelopment project, has a capacity of 9,380 and promises to host some of the biggest names in entertainment in its inaugural year.
